What is notary public bond application?
Notary public bond application is a form that must be completed and submitted by individuals seeking to become a notary public. This application typically includes information about the applicant's background, qualifications, and contact information.
Who is required to file notary public bond application?
Individuals who wish to become a notary public are required to file a notary public bond application.
How to fill out notary public bond application?
To fill out a notary public bond application, the applicant must provide accurate and complete information about their personal details, qualifications, and contact information. They must also include any required documentation or certificates.
What is the purpose of notary public bond application?
The purpose of the notary public bond application is to verify the qualifications and background of individuals applying to become notary public. It helps ensure that only qualified individuals are granted the authority to notarize documents.
What information must be reported on notary public bond application?
The notary public bond application typically requires information such as the applicant's name, address, contact information, qualifications, background, and any relevant certifications or training.
